Insight Global is looking to hire a Workday Integration Analyst to join one of the largest non-profit healthcare systems in the US. This position is responsible for supporting the Epic Gold EHR project within our Supply & Service Resource Management (SSRM) workstream. In this role, you will be responsible for providing expertise in ERP to Epic data integration and interfacing solutions, ensuring the smooth flow of data between our ERP systems and various EHR applications. Your in-depth knowledge and problem-solving abilities will be vital in driving our commitment to healthcare excellence through technology. Other responsibilities include:

-Interface Development: Support the design, development, testing, and implementation of healthcare data

interfaces, connecting our ERP systems with electronic health records (EHR), point of use systems, billing

systems, 3rd party point of use systems and other healthcare applications.

-Subject Matter Expertise: Over time serve as one of SSRM's go-to experts on ERP to EHR interfaces and jobs

including their various setups, requirements, timing, and data standards.

-Collaboration: Gather interface and job requirements to ensure successful implementation, work closely with

cross-functional teams, including software developers, data engineers, project managers, national and facility

leaders.

-Interface and Job Maintenance: Monitor, troubleshoot, and maintain supply chain interfaces and jobs to

guarantee data accuracy, consistency, and availability. Take corrective actions in case of any discrepancies or

failures.

-Integrations and Divestitures: Monitor, configure, test, maintain, and support the integration or divestiture of

enterprise wide or division interfaces and jobs.

-Data Security and Compliance: Ensure that all data transfer and integration activities comply with relevant

healthcare regulations, including HIPAA, and prioritize patient data privacy and security.

-Documentation: Maintain comprehensive documentation of interface configurations, standards, and protocols

for reference and auditing purposes.

-Continuous Improvement: Keep abreast of emerging trends and technologies in healthcare data integration and

recommend enhancements to our ERP systems.

-Training and Support: Provide training and support to end-users and technical teams to ensure proper utilization

of enterprise wide or division interfaces. This includes attending and/or leading meetings.

-Agile: Work in an agile environment across developers, analysts, project managers, leaders, and stakeholders

utilizing Azure DevOps or a similar project management system.

Skills and Requirements

-Must have experience supporting the set-up, configuration and testing of integrations between ERP and EHR systems

-Strongly preferred to have Supply Chain experience

-Experience with Epic integrations

-Bachelor's Degree or 5-7 years of relevant experience

-An understanding of healthcare data standards, including HL7, FHIR, and DICOM; and compliance regulations, such as HIPAA.

-Excellent problem-solving, communication, and teamwork

skills.

-Must be willing to work 8am-4:00pm MST -Workday Supply Chain experience

-Experience with Cerner or Meditech
